CARBON FIBER STRENGTHENING

Carbon fiber can add tremendous strength and durability to existing structural members without taking up the precious space in different types of structures such as office and parking facilities.

Carbon fiber is a technology that is becoming widely used in the construction industry, for good reason. Carbon fiber may be the solution that is both simple, as it’s least burdensome from a construction schedule stand point, and cost effective in materials. Carbon fiber added to existing structures can not only extend the life of your investment, it can also add flexibility to the original design of the structure. Either turning industrial space to residential, industrial to educational facilities or bringing a bridge up to the current necessary loads, carbon fiber is durable and affordable, making it an excellent solution for the right project.
 
The carbon fiber strengthening technique can be extremely important for older structures which have experienced usual corrosion and deterioration over time. When elements of these properties decay it puts them at risk for further breakdown and major safety issues in the future. The damage can also make the problem areas appear rickety and unpleasant. Carbon fiber strengthening is a long-lasting solution that can be custom fitted to each property. It is applied in whatever length necessary for the most support, which means our experts at D&R Masonry Restoration can give you exactly what you need for keep everything stable.
 
The service is a fantastic choice because it can be applied long after original construction, it doesn’t have a lot weight so it doesn’t put unnecessary pressure onto old beams, looks neat, doesn’t take up space, works well under numerous different conditions and in many applications, and can seriously stand the test of time. This means it can be a great method to use for anyone who wishes to reinforce their project in advance. Building standards obviously move forward and change over time, so improving your site from the get go will help keep it up to date and ahead of the curve.
 
By improving the seismic withstanding capabilities of sites, carbon fiber strengthening allows your property to feel safer while retaining its signature style, look, and feel. The service can work with walls, beams, and much more, including columns, bridges, and slabs. Because of this, carbon fiber strengthening can also be useful for increasing the load bearing capacity of older structures which were created to different standards. This is obviously particularly helpful for bridges, parking garages, and other similar projects.
